Neighborhood Overview

Fort Couch Middle School is situated in Upper St. Clair, a well-regarded township in the southern part of Allegheny County, just a short drive from downtown Pittsburgh. The school benefits from its location along major thoroughfares, providing convenient access to different parts of the metropolitan area. Key roads like Fort Couch Road, McLaughlin Run Road, and South Route 19 (Washington Road) serve as primary arteries for local and regional travel. Pittsburgh International Airport (PIT) is the closest major airport, typically a 30-40 minute drive away, depending on traffic conditions. Navigating to and from the school is generally straightforward, though it's wise to anticipate increased traffic during peak hours, especially on weekdays when school is in session and during local events. Utilizing GPS is recommended to find the most direct routes and avoid potential construction or detours. Public transportation options are available but less frequent in this suburban setting, making personal vehicles or rideshare services the most common methods for reaching the school and surrounding amenities.

Primanti Bros.

1.9 mi

A Pittsburgh institution, Primanti Bros. is famous for its signature sandwiches piled high with grilled meat, coleslaw, and French fries between two thick slices of Italian bread. This casual, lively spot is perfect for a hearty and iconic Pittsburgh meal. It's a no-fuss environment that’s ideal for feeding hungry athletes and families looking for a taste of local flavor without breaking the bank.

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Pittsburgh brings cold temperatures, with average highs in the low 40s and lows often dipping into the 20s. Snowfall is common, which can impact travel times and outdoor comfort. Visitors should pack warm layers, including heavy coats, hats, gloves, and waterproof footwear, especially if attending events that involve significant time outdoors. Indoor activities and dining become more prominent during this season.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ring brings gradually warming temperatures, with average highs climbing into the 60s and 70s by late spring and early summer. The weather can be variable, with a mix of sunny days and occasional rain showers. Layered clothing is recommended, as mornings can be cool while afternoons warm up considerably. It's a great time for outdoor activities before the peak summer heat arrives.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er (July and August) is characterized by warm to hot and humid conditions, with average daily highs in the upper 70s and 80s. High humidity can make it feel warmer. Lightweight, breathable clothing is essential. Staying hydrated and seeking shade or air-conditioned venues during the hottest parts of the day is advisable. Outdoor sporting events are in full swing, but breaks and access to water are crucial.

🍂

Fall season

Fall offers crisp, cool air and beautiful foliage, with average highs in the 50s and 60s. Mornings and evenings can be quite chilly, so packing layers, including a light jacket or sweater, is essential. This season is ideal for enjoying outdoor activities and scenic drives. By late fall, temperatures begin to drop more significantly, signaling the approach of winter.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ain is possible throughout the year in Pittsburgh, with heavier periods often occurring in spring and summer. Snow is typical during winter months, with accumulations varying annually. Both rain and snow can affect visibility and road conditions, so drivers should exercise caution and allow extra travel time. Waterproof outerwear and footwear are recommended during wet or snowy periods to ensure comfort during transit and outdoor activities.
